1776 $1 Continental Dollar, CURRENCY, Pewter XF40 PCGS. CAC.
Newman 2-C, W-8455, R.3. The five obverse dies identified for
the Continental dollars including three different spellings of
CURRENCY, including CURENCY and CURRENCEY. This example displays
the correct spelling with perhaps 200 to 300 pieces known in all
grades. The present specimen, housed in a PCGS green-label holder,
offers pleasing pewter-gray surfaces with a few splashes of rich
steel toning. The surfaces are quite nice, showing only a few
trivial circulation marks on each side. An excellent example for
the colonial specialist or type collector.Coin Index Numbers: (NGC ID# 2AYT, PCGS# 794, Greysheet# 79)
